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> प्रोग्रामिंग

क्या हम जेएसपी में XPath अभिव्यक्ति का परीक्षण कर सकते हैं?

टैग एक परीक्षण XPath व्यंजक का मूल्यांकन करता है और अगर यह सच है, तो यह अपने शरीर को संसाधित करता है। यदि परीक्षण की स्थिति गलत है, तो शरीर पर ध्यान नहीं दिया जाता है।

विशेषता

टैग में निम्नलिखित विशेषताएं हैं -

<वें शैली ="पाठ-संरेखण:केंद्र;">विवरण <वें शैली="पाठ्य-संरेखण:केंद्र;">डिफ़ॉल्ट
विशेषता आवश्यक
चुनें XPath एक्सप्रेशन का मूल्यांकन किया जाना है हां कोई नहीं
var स्थिति के परिणाम को संग्रहीत करने के लिए चर का नाम नहीं कोई नहीं
दायरा वर विशेषता में निर्दिष्ट चर का दायरा नहीं पेज

उदाहरण

निम्नलिखित एक उदाहरण है जो . के उपयोग को दर्शाता है टैग -

<%@ taglib prefix = "c" uri = "https://java.sun.com/jsp/jstl/core" %>
<%@ taglib prefix = "x" uri = "https://java.sun.com/jsp/jstl/xml" %>
<html>
   <head>
      <title>JSTL x:if Tags</title>
   </head>
   <body>
      <h3>Books Info:</h3>
      <c:set var = "xmltext">
         <books>
            <book>
               <name>Padam History</name>
               <author>ZARA</author>
               <price>100</price>
            </book>
            <book>
               <name>Great Mistry</name>
               <author>NUHA</author>
               <price>2000</price>
            </book>
         </books>
      </c:set>
      <x:parse xml = "${xmltext}" var = "output"/>
      <x:if select = "$output//book">
         Document has at least one <book> element.
      </x:if>
      <br />
      <x:if select = "$output/books[1]/book/price > 100">
         Book prices are very high
      </x:if>
   </body>
</html>

आइए अब उपरोक्त JSP तक पहुँचें, निम्नलिखित परिणाम प्रदर्शित होंगे -

Books Info:
Document has at least one <book> element.
Book prices are very high

  1. जेएसपी पृष्ठों का परीक्षण करने के लिए टॉमकैट जैसे वेब सर्वर को कैसे सेटअप करें?

    Apache Tomcat JavaServer पेज और सर्वलेट तकनीकों का एक ओपन सोर्स सॉफ्टवेयर कार्यान्वयन है और JSP और सर्वलेट्स के परीक्षण के लिए एक स्टैंडअलोन सर्वर के रूप में कार्य कर सकता है, और इसे Apache वेब सर्वर के साथ एकीकृत किया जा सकता है। आपकी मशीन पर टॉमकैट सेट करने के चरण यहां दिए गए हैं - टॉमकैट का नव

  1. अब आप Windows 10s टाइमलाइन फ़ीचर का परीक्षण कर सकते हैं

    माइक्रोसॉफ्ट ने विंडोज इनसाइडर्स के लिए नवीनतम विंडोज 10 बिल्ड जारी किया है, और यह विंडोज 10 की नई टाइमलाइन फीचर की लंबे समय से प्रतीक्षित शुरुआत है। विंडोज 10 प्रीव्यू बिल्ड 17063 अभी फास्ट रिंग में विंडोज इनसाइडर्स के लिए उपलब्ध है या जिन्होंने स्किप अहेड का विकल्प चुना है। बिल्ड 2017 में, माइक्र

  1. हम C# Asp.Net WebAPI का परीक्षण कैसे कर सकते हैं?

    वेबएपी के परीक्षण में एक अनुरोध भेजना और प्रतिक्रिया प्राप्त करना शामिल है। WebAPI का परीक्षण करने के कई तरीके हैं। यहां हम पोस्टमैन और स्वैगर का उपयोग करके वेबएपी का परीक्षण करेंगे। आइए नीचे की तरह एक स्टूडेंटकंट्रोलर बनाएं। छात्र मॉडल namespace DemoWebApplication.Models{    public class